Ajinomoto Windsor chicken and poultry products recalled for potential Listeria contamination
Do not eat Ajinomoto Windsor chicken products
Ajinomoto Windsor, Inc. recalled approximately 47 million pounds of frozen chicken and poultry products produced between May 2014 and May 2016 because they may be contaminated with Listeria monocytogenes. The products were not fully cooked and include multiple brand names sold at major retailers.
- Check your freezer for any recalled products listed (Tai Pei, Trader Joe's, InnovASIAN, Simmering Samurai, HyVee, First Street, and other brands)
- Do not eat these products
- Throw away any recalled items or return them to the store
- Contact your healthcare provider if you have consumed these products and feel sick
